Cantalupo Ligure is a comune in the provincia of Alessandria, Piemonte with a population of 441 as of 2025. Between 1830 and 1912, at least 4 passengers departing from Cantalupo Ligure arrived in the United States. The comune was previously known as Cantalupo.

Population and Migration
This chart shows annual resident population, US arrivals (1830 to 1912), and international migration (2001 to present). Not all data is available for every period, so gaps are normal.
The population has declined 68% since 1861. US arrivals peaked in 1912 with 4 recorded passengers. Since 2001, net international immigration has added the equivalent of 12% of the current population.
